Banks Expect Writedowns on Brazil Loans: Bankers in New York said the Interagency County Exposure Review Committee is expected to require banks to write down a large percentage of their outstanding loans to Brazil, perhaps within a week. the committee is made up of membersof the Federal Reserve Board, the Office of the Controller of the Currency and the FederalDeposit Insurance Corp.
